Automotive Ad Examples

Automotive ads serve a local, high-consideration buyer weighing a major purchase, so specific inventory, transparent pricing, and financing clarity drive the lead. Whether selling cars or service, the winners reduce the anxiety of a big decision with concrete offers and trust. These examples show how to turn a shopper into a showroom visit.

Specific model + monthly payment

Why it works: Leading with an actual model and "$0 down, $299/mo" gives serious shoppers the concrete numbers they're comparing. Specificity qualifies real buyers and beats vague "great deals" copy. The payment reframes a big price into a manageable one.

Financing / bad-credit-OK hook

Why it works: "Financing for all credit types" speaks directly to buyers who assume they can't qualify, a huge underserved segment. It removes the biggest psychological barrier to visiting a dealer. The reassurance drives leads competitors ignore.

Limited-time sales event

Why it works: A dated event ("Memorial Day blowout, ends Monday") creates urgency for a purchase that's easy to delay. The deadline compresses the decision. Local targeting ensures the traffic can actually reach the lot.

Service offer (oil change, brakes)

Why it works: A fixed-price service special fills the service bay and opens a relationship with future car buyers. Transparent pricing builds trust in a distrusted category. It's a low-risk entry that leads to bigger repair and sales revenue.

Trade-in value hook

Why it works: "Get top dollar for your trade-in" motivates upgraders by addressing the money they'll get, not just spend. It reframes the purchase as more affordable. The CTA to a quick appraisal captures a high-intent lead.

Dealer trust / reviews + guarantee

Why it works: Car buyers fear high-pressure tactics, so reviews and a no-haggle or satisfaction guarantee lower defenses. Trust cues differentiate an honest dealer from the stereotype. They make a shopper more willing to visit.

Frequently asked questions

What makes an automotive ad convert?

Concrete numbers and reduced anxiety. Specific models with monthly payments qualify serious buyers, while financing clarity and trust cues lower the barriers to a big, high-consideration purchase.

Should automotive ads show pricing?

Yes — for both sales and service. Monthly payments and fixed service prices give shoppers the numbers they compare and build trust in a category where buyers fear hidden costs and pressure.

How do dealers overcome buyer distrust in ads?

With reviews, guarantees, and transparent, no-pressure messaging. Car buyers expect high-pressure tactics, so signaling honesty and easy financing options lowers defenses and drives showroom visits.
